How much do entry level software engineer internship j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 8, 2026, the average hourly pay for entry level software engineer internship in Evanston, IL is $24.39,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.86 and $27.69 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an entry level software engineer internship?

An Entry Level Software Engineer Internship is a temporary position designed for students or recent graduates to gain hands-on experience in software development. Interns typically work under the guidance of experienced engineers, assisting with coding, debugging, testing, and documentation. This role helps build technical skills, familiarity with industry tools, and teamwork experience. It can also serve as a pathway to full-time employment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the entry level software engineer internship position,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Software Engineer Intern, you need a solid understanding of programming fundamentals (such as data structures, algorithms, and basic coding), often demonstrated through coursework or personal projects. Familiarity with development tools like Git, integrated development environments (IDEs), and commonly used languages (like Python, Java, or JavaScript) is typically required, and exposure to version control systems is valuable. Strong problem-solving abilities, eagerness to learn, teamwork, and effective communication are important soft skills to stand out in this role. These combined skills enable interns to quickly contribute to projects, collaborate productively with experienced engineers, and gain the most from their internship experience.

What types of projects do entry level software engineer interns typically work on during their internships?

Entry Level Software Engineer Interns often contribute to real-world projects under the mentorship of senior engineers, which might include bug fixes, feature enhancements, or developing new application components. You may participate in code reviews, collaborate in agile development sprints, and help with software testing or documentation. The projects are designed to match your skill level while also providing hands-on learning and exposure to industry-standard development processes. This experience helps interns build a strong foundation for future full-time roles and understand how software teams operate in a professional environment.

Voted one of Chicago's Best Places to Work by the Chicago Tribune for the ninth consecutive year, Clarity Partners is hiring!
Clarity Partners is seeking a Salesforce Developer Intern who is passionate about software development and excited to build solutions on the Salesforce platform. Working alongside experienced Salesforce developers and architects, you'll gain hands-on experience designing, developing, testing, and deploying applications that help our clients improve their business processes. This internship is ideal for students interested in software engineering, cloud technologies, and enterprise application development. Clarity's internship program requires fulltime onsite reporting.
Responsibilities:
  • Assist in developing and configuring Salesforce applications using declarative and programmatic tools.
  • Support the creation of Lightning components, Flows, Apex classes, triggers, and integrations under the guidance of senior developers.
  • Participate in code reviews, debugging, testing, and deployment activities.
  • Help troubleshoot production issues and support ongoing enhancements.
  • Write technical documentation, contribute to development standards, and best practices.
  • Collaborate with Business Analysts, Project Managers, and other developers to translate business requirements into technical solutions.
  • Gain exposure to Salesforce DevOps, version control, CI/CD processes, and Agile development methodologies.
  • Learn consulting best practices while working on real client engagements.

Requirements
Requirements:
  • Completed at least two years toward a bachelor's degree in computer science, Software Engineering, Information Systems, or a related technical field.
  • Coursework or experience with object-oriented programming.
  • Familiarity with one or more programming languages such as Java, C#, JavaScript, Python, or Apex.
  • Basic understanding of databases and SQL concepts.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ills.
  • Exposure to Salesforce, web development, Git, REST APIs, or cloud platforms is preferred but not required.
  • Eagerness to learn new technologies and work in a collaborative consulting environment.
